BRIAN LOHAN has made two changes to the Clare senior hurling team for Saturday’s meeting with reigning All-Ireland, Munster and National Hurling League champions Limerick.

Eibhear Quilligan replaces Eamonn Foudy between the posts for Clare while injury rules Ryan Taylor out of the starting fifteen though he is named on the bench, David Fitzgerald’s one match suspension has been served and he will make his first championship appearance of the year.

Fitzgerald is named to partner Cathal Malone at midfield. The back six remains unchanged despite conceding five goals last weekend.

Tony Kelly captains the side from centre forward where he is flanked by Peter Duggan and Aidan McCarthy. Mark Rodgers who scored two goals last weekend joins Shane O’Donnell and Ian Galvin in the full-forward line.

Seadna Morey returns to the bench following a hamstring injury. Both Paddy Donnellan and Brandon O’Connell miss out on the matchday twenty six this weekend.

Reports emerged this week that Limerick captain Declan Hannon was set for a month on the sidelines with a groin injury but the Adare man is named at centre back for John Kiely’s side. Gearoid Hegarty is dropped from the starting team with Cathal O’Neill entering the fray at wing forward as a result.
